Montenegro in 1914

Montenegro had been fighting for its independence from Turkey for over 600 years. In 1912 Montenegro joined with Greece, Serbia and Bulgaria in a war with Turkey. This Balkan War helped to reinforce Montenegro's independence from Turkey.

By 1914 Montenegro had a population of about half a million. Most of its 15,000 square kilometres was mountainous. Although fairly small, the Montenegrin Army contained experienced guerrilla fighters and would be a useful ally if war broke out in Europe.
